What are some well - known African American classic novels?

Richard Wright's 'Native Son' is also a significant African - American classic. It follows the life of Bigger Thomas, a young African - American man living in Chicago's South Side. The book shows how the oppressive environment and systemic racism shape Bigger's life and lead to tragic consequences.

What are some well - known African classic novels?

Nadine Gordimer's 'July's People' is also considered a classic. It explores the complex relationship between the races during a time of political upheaval in South Africa. The story is about a white family that has to rely on their black servant, July, for survival during a civil war - like situation.

Can you recommend some well - known African and African American novels?

Sure. For African novels, 'The Palm - Wine Drinkard' by Amos Tutuola is quite famous. It's a unique blend of Yoruba folktales and modern storytelling. Another is 'Half of a Yellow Sun' by Chimamanda Ngozi Adichie, which tells the story of the Biafran War in Nigeria. For African American novels, 'Invisible Man' by Ralph Ellison is a classic that delves into the invisibility of African Americans in society. 'Native Son' by Richard Wright is also well - known, exploring themes of race, poverty, and violence in the context of African American life in Chicago.

Who are some well - known authors of African American feminist novels?

Alice Walker is a very well - known author. Her novel 'The Color Purple' is a classic in African American feminist literature. It tells the story of Celie, a poor, uneducated black woman in the South who overcomes great hardships and abuse. Walker's writing is known for its vivid portrayal of the lives of African American women and their struggles for equality and self - expression.

Who are some well - known authors of African American teenage novels?

Mildred D. Taylor has made great contributions as well. With her novel 'Roll of Thunder, Hear My Cry', she has given voice to African American teenagers in the context of the segregated South. Her writing is rich in historical detail and emotional depth.
